Parsons AvenueTransmission Project


AEP Ohio representatives plan power grid upgrades to improve electric reliability for customers in south Columbus and provide power to a future customer.

The Parsons Avenue Transmission Project involves:

  • Upgrading Parsons Substation near the intersection of Rathmell Road and Parsons Avenue
  • Building Cyprus Substation near the intersection of Rathmell Road and Parsons Avenue, south of Parsons Substation
  • Building approximately 3 miles of 138-kilovolt (kV) transmission line connecting Cyprus and Parsons substations to an existing transmission line near the I-270 and US-23 interchange
  • Retiring approximately 5 miles of 40-kV transmission line along Parsons Avenue

The planned improvements provide a new power source to strengthen the local electric power grid, provide power to a future customer in the area and support economic development.

Company officials expect construction to begin in fall 2021 and conclude in summer 2023.

Project Updates

August 2022:

All regulatory filings associate with this project have received approval from the Ohio Power Siting Board. Construction on the new substation and transmission lines are ongoing. Removal of the aging transmission line is planned for 2023, once the new substation and lines are in service.

October 2021:

AEP Ohio representatives have filed a Letter of Notification for 2.3 miles of 138-kV transmission line connecting the new Cyprus Substation to an existing transmission line with the Ohio Power Siting Board as the Cyprus 138 kV Extension Project, Case No. 21-1056-EL-BLN. The Letter of Notification to construct, operate and maintain this facility awaits OPSB review.

AEP Ohio representatives have filed a Construction Notice for .6 miles of 138-kV transmission line connecting the proposed Cyprus Substation to the customer's substation with the Ohio Power Siting Board as Hartman Farms 138 kV Extension No. 5 and No. 6 Project, Case No. 21-1057-EL-BNR. The Construction Notice to construct, operate and maintain this facility awaits OPSB review.

July 2021:

AEP Ohio representatives have filed a Letter of Notification with the Ohio Power Siting Board for the proposed Cyprus Substation. The Letter of Notification to construct, operate and maintain this facility awaits OPSB review.

April 2021:

  • AEP Ohio officials have filed a Letter of Notification with the Ohio Power Siting Board (OPSB) in April to build .3 miles of 138-kV transmission line connecting Cyprus and Parsons substations.
  • AEP Ohio officials have filed a Construction Notice with the OPSB in February to replace an existing structure with a steel two-pole structure near the I-270 and US-23 interchange.
  • Construction has started on Cyprus Substation and the transmission line extension connecting Cyprus Substation to an existing transmission line near the I-270 and US-23 interchange. Construction for these components are scheduled to be completed in August.

Structures

Structure

The project involves installing steel poles.

Typical Pole Height: Approximately 100 feet*
Right-of-Way Width: Approximately 80-100 feet*

* Exact structure, height and right-of-way may vary
